Early Life and Musical Beginnings

Curtis Mayfield was born on June 3, 1942, in Chicago, Illinois. His early life was marked by a deep connection to music, nurtured by his mother and grandmother.

By the age of seven, he was singing in a gospel choir, setting the foundation for his future in the music industry.

The Impressions and Their Impact

Mayfield’s career took off when he joined The Impressions. The group became famous during the civil rights movement with hits like People Get Ready, which he wrote. This song, along with others, played a significant role in the movement, providing anthems of hope and resilience.

Transition to Solo Career

In 1970, he embarked on a solo career, releasing his debut album Curtis. The album’s success was a testament to his ability to address social issues through music.

It predated Marvin Gaye’s What’s Going On, offering a similar socially conscious message.

Financial Success from Super Fly Soundtrack

Mayfield’s work on the Super Fly soundtrack in 1972 was a major financial success. The soundtrack, addressing themes of crime and drug abuse, topped the Billboard charts and sold over 12 million copies. It solidified his place as a significant figure in music.

Establishment and Success of Curtom Records

Mayfield founded Curtom Records in 1968, providing a platform for his music and other artists. The label was home to various successful acts, contributing significantly to his wealth.

Through Curtom Records, Mayfield produced numerous hits, expanding his influence in the music industry.

Continued Influence and Later Career

Despite a debilitating accident in 1990, he continued to produce music. He recorded the album New World Order in 1996, showcasing his resilience and dedication to his craft.

His influence extended beyond his active years, with his music remaining relevant and inspiring.

Awards and Recognitions

Mayfield’s contributions were recognized with numerous awards, including the Grammy Lifetime Achievement Award and double inductions into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ame. These accolades reflect his enduring impact on music and culture.

Personal Life

Mayfield was married twice and had ten children. His personal life was marked by both triumphs and challenges, including his battle with diabetes and the impact of his paralysis.

Despite these challenges, he remained a significant figure in music until his passing in 1999.

Who was Curtis Mayfield?

He was an influential American singer-songwriter, guitarist, and record producer. He worked with The Impressions and had a successful solo career.

What are some of Mayfield’s most famous songs?

Some of his famous songs include People Get Ready, Superfly, Freddie’s Dead, Move On Up, and Pusherman.

What was Mayfield’s role in the civil rights movement?

He used his music to address social issues and advocate for equality. Songs like People Get Ready and Keep On Pushing became anthems for the civil rights movement.

What is the significance of the album Superfly?

The Superfly album, released in 1972, blended soul, funk, and R&B. It provided a sociopolitical commentary on urban life and was an influential Blaxploitation soundtrack.

How did Mayfield’s music influence hip-hop?

Mayfield’s music has been widely sampled in hip-hop for its soulful grooves and impactful lyrics. His tracks have been used by artists like Kanye West, Kendrick Lamar, and The Pharcyde.

What happened to Curtis Mayfield in 1990?

In 1990, he was paralyzed from the neck down after a lighting rig fell on him during a concert. He continued to create music, recording his vocals lying down for his final album, New World Order.

Did Mayfield receive any major awards?

Yes, he was in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ame twice. He also received a Grammy Legend Award and a Grammy Lifetime Achievement Award.

What impact did Mayfield have on music genres like soul and funk?

He was a pioneer in blending soul, funk, and gospel influences. His distinctive sound resonated with audiences worldwide and set a new standard for these genres.

How did Mayfield address social issues in his music?

His lyrics tackled themes such as poverty, inequality, and civil rights. Songs like We’re a Winner and Choice of Colors reflect his commitment to social justice.

What were the circumstances of Mayfield’s death?

He died on December 26, 1999, due to complications from diabetes. His health had declined following his accident and paralysis.

What was Mayfield’s early life like?

Born on June 3, 1942, in Chicago, Illinois, Mayfield grew up in the Cabrini-Green housing project. His early exposure to gospel music in church influenced his musical style.
